How to Choose your Load rating

When first selecting the correct drawer slide, also known as ball bearing slides, for your application you must consider the correct amount of force that you are loading onto the application which is supported by the slide.

Measurements are taken between and at the midpoint of the drawer member and are given in KG.

Horizontal (flat) mounting

Horizontally (flat) mounting the slides reduces the load capacity to at least 25% of the vertical (side) mount capacity. Not all slide models can be used in flat mount applications. Be sure to evaluate the mounting scheme thoroughly and test as needed. For horizontally mounted slides look for the symbol below on the product page. Linear slides are ideal for flat mounting because the moving member is fully supported on ball bearings at all times. Speak to our sales team for slides that can be flat mounted.

External Factors AFFECTING choosing the correct load rating

Shock/vibration

Subjecting slides to shock and vibration may adversely affect their performance. Applications that are subject to these conditions should be tested to evaluate the effect on slide performance. If conditions are severe, select a heavier-duty slide.

Application factors

When installed in a drawer or cabinet that’s lightweight and flexible, drawer slides can contribute to the structural rigidity of the unit. To ensure that the slide is able to provide this support, select a model with a slightly higher load rating and larger cross-section than you would ordinarily need for the application.

Environmental factors

Accuride slides are designed for indoor use and should be protected from excessive moisture, chemical fumes, dirt and corrosion. The Accuride self-cleaning ball retainer protects slide raceways by removing foreign particles between ball bearings and the lubricant provided is sufficient for normal slide life.

Use care when applying finishing agents as the overspray may affect slide movement. Should you need to clean the slides, you can re-lubricate them with a quality grease-rated "EP" for extreme pressure.

Extreme temperatures can also affect the lubricant and plastic or rubber components. Commercial drawer slides are designed to be used for extended periods in temperatures between -17°C and 70°C.

Please note: In general, wider drawers require a slide with a higher load rating and a cross-section designed to withstand lateral stress. Slide extension or travel

Extension and travel refers to how far the drawer extends from the cabinet.

  • 75% extension: drawer opens approximately 75% of the total length of the slide
  • 100% extension: drawer opens the same amount as the slide length
  • 100+% extension: over-travel is achieved. The drawer opens in excess of the slide length
  • Most full (100%) extension slides have nominal over-travel.
  • Linear motion slides move in a straight line and within the slide’s own length
  • Two-way travel - provides access from both sides of the drawer

Side space

Side space is the amount of available room between the drawer side and the cabinet or the chassis and rack. The correct side space dimension is critical for optimal movement. We recommend allowing between +0.2mm and +0.5mm over the nominal slide thickness. Some slides may need more room, but this will be stated on the individual installation guides.

Slide profiles

More than one slide profile (or height) may be appropriate for a given application. JET PRESS offers several low-profile design options for applications in which a smaller slide profile would enhance the appearance of the completed unit.

Determine Special Features you may require

Disconnect allows simple connect or disconnect from the slide assembly

  • Lever - disconnect is achieved by releasing an internal lever and by pulling the drawer firmly through the resistance of the ball retainer
  • Push latch - a latch is pressed to release the drawer and disconnect is achieved by pulling the drawer firmly through the resistance of the ball retainer

Locks hold the slide either closed or open and a lever must be actuated to move the slide

Hold-in and hold-out keeps the slide open or closed until the extra force is applied

Self-close slides include a spring attachment designed to close the slide and prevent bouncing back

Touch release slides open with pressure to the front of the slide

Cycle tests

All drawer slides undergo cycle tests according to the expected frequency of use. See individual slides for details on the cycle test rating. The load ratings will change according to the length of the slide. Mounting slides in different configurations will affect the performance and load rating, please see below. We advise clients to test slides in the intended application.

Installation

Most slides are designed to be mounted in pairs on the sides of drawers or the moving unit. When installing the slides, care should be taken to ensure that they are mounted parallel to each other, in vertical and horizontal axes. The measurements taken are between and at the midpoint of the drawer member and are given in kg.

Before mounting slides other than as designed, carefully consider any potential adverse effects on the slide.

Mounting holes

Mounting holes are indicated and dimensioned on product technical sheets. Only those holes shown with a dimension are to be used for mounting. Non-dimensioned holes are tooling holes that often vary in shape and location on slide members. Please refer to 2D CAD drawings for dimensional tolerances

Length

Slide length is measured as the longest dimension of a fully closed slide. As a rule, always use the maximum length possible in an application.
